LSAT/ GPA Trends
My question is more directed at schools outside of the top 10(who won't probably ever have a shortage of applicants with both high median LSAT/GPA), but with Law School applications dropping pretty significantly in general, and average GPA of graduates increasing. Do law schools start to value LSAT more than GPA when evaluating admissions/scholarship decisions. It doesn't seem like many schools are having problems keeping median GPA's high, but it does seem like more and more schools are scrambling to keep their LSAT medians from falling.
